南海海底地磁日变站布放选址方法

摘    要:南海海底地形以复杂著称,适合布放沉底自容式观测仪器的海区不多.通过对南海海底地形、水深、通航条件及作业时间的科学合理分析,为南海海域海底日变站布防选址提供了有效方法并取得良好的实际效果,确保了南海水下地磁日变观测的安全性.

关 键 词:海洋磁力测量  地磁日变站  选址  布放  南海

Address Selection for Laying Geomagnetism Observation Mooring System on South China Sea Floor

Abstract:The South China Sea is famous for its seafloor complex terrain. A few part of sea area can be suitable for laying self-contained observation instruments on the sea floor. In general, finding suitable laying address is the premise and basis of the whole observation work. Through analyzing the local marine terrain, water depth, navigation condition and operation time, we provide the efficient methods for address selection to lay the geomagnetic observation station on the seafloor in the South China Sea, and get the real effect to ensure the security of the underwater geomagnetic diurnal observation.
Keywords:marine magnetic survey  geomagnetic diurnal station  suitable address  underwater laying  South China Sea
